Reports To: Director of Carborne System Data Maintenance
Location: 130 Livingston Street, Brooklyn, NY
Hours of work: 8:00 AM – 4:00 PM
Compensation:
$90,590.00 - $128,239.00/Grade E
Responsibilities:
This position will provide essential engineering/project support to facilitate CBTC carborne implementation of CBTC projects. Manage a group to assure CBTC carborne designs adhere to established MTA NYCT specification and contractual requirements and assure CBTC carborne equipment installations adhere to approved documentation. Provide crucial support for testing, inspection, analysis and reliability tracking for CBTC equipment on subway cars to help assure acceptable CBTC operations during CBTC roll-out, cutover, stabilization periods, and post warranty.
Education and Experience:
A baccalaureate degree from an accredited college or university in Electrical Engineering and seven (7) years of satisfactory related experience, and four (4) years of experience in a managerial/supervisory capacity.
Desired Skills:
Working knowledge of new and cutting-edge technology in heavy railcar engineering.
Working knowledge of transit rail vehicle systems and their interface/interaction with new technology wayside equipment.
Thorough understanding of design, testing, troubleshooting, failure analysis and corrective action related to railcars, control systems and CBTC.
Experience with the NYCT environment, car and wayside equipment, technical document control and engineering.
Selection Method:
Based on evaluation of education, skills, experience, and interview.
